dc.description.abstract The presented overview of hypergene metallogeny of the Urals is largely based on original data of the author. All bauxite, Co–Ni oxide–silicate, and high-grade ferromanganese our deposits, gold, platinum, and diamond placers, as well as brown coal, kaoline, refractory, and other economic-grade mineral deposits, currently mined in the Urals are hosted in hypergene zones and related hypergene blankets of different ages. Prospects for diverse mineral deposits are estimated with a special emphasis on thermal hypergene deposits (Ni, Au, and others) that are atypical for the Urals but favorable for mining under conditions of the market economy owing to the presence of high-grade ore bodies.
